Overlooking window problems can result in more significant issues down the line. For instance, a broken window can enable moisture to enter, causing mold development and wood rot. Additionally, improperly sealed Home Window Installers can considerably increase cooling and heating costs. Timely repairs can conserve homeowners from these prospective hazards and expenditures.

A: Look for signs such as drafts, condensation between panes, trouble in opening or closing, fractures in the glass, or noticeable water damage around the window frame.
Q2: Can I repair my windows myself?
A: While some repair work, such as weather removing, can be done DIY, it's advisable to employ a professional for extensive damages or glass replacements due to security concerns and the need for specialized tools.
Q3: How long do window repair work generally take?
A: Depending on the nature of the repair, the majority of window repair work can typically be finished in a couple of hours. More substantial repair work may take longer, specifically if custom parts require to be ordered.
Q4: Are window repair work covered by property owners insurance?
A: Many homeowners insurance coverage policies cover window repair work, especially if the damage is because of an insured hazard like a storm or vandalism. It's best to examine your policy for specific coverage information.
Q5: How can I maintain my windows to prevent future repair work?
A: Regular cleansing, examination for any damages, using weather removing as needed, and ensuring appropriate drain can help keep your windows and avoid future problems.
